Two Circles Partners with PSA to Expand Squash Audiences for LA28

Main News:

* the Professional Squash Association (PSA), through its commercial arm Squash media and Marketing (SMM), has partnered with sports marketing agency Two Circles for five years.

Purpose of the Partnership:

* to raise the profile of squash, especially leading up to its debut at the Los Angeles 2028 Olympic Games.
* To grow SMM’s digital platform and audiences,including SquashTV.
* To expand the reach of the PSA Squash Tour through new rights sales.
* To attract new audiences and unlock new revenue streams.

What Two Circles Will Do:

* Provide media rights strategy and distribution services.
* Offer data and marketing support.
* Provide insights into audiences, markets, and growth opportunities.

Quote:

* Alex Gough, CEO of PSA, stated the partnership will help expand global distribution, accelerate squashtv subscriber growth, and build momentum for the sport through 2028 and beyond.

Background:

* Squash was officially added to the LA28 Olympic program in October 2023.
